The travel time between Herne Bay and Billingshurst by train varies depending on the type of train and the route, but the average journey time is 4hrs 24 mins & the fastest journey takes 3hrs 25 mins.
The fastest journey time by train from Herne Bay to Billingshurst is 3hrs 25 mins.
Train ticket prices from Herne Bay to Billingshurst can start from as little as £27.00 when you book in advance. The cost of tickets can vary depending on the time of day, route and class you book and are usually more expensive if you book on the day.
The departure and arrival times for trains between Herne Bay and Billingshurst vary depending on the day of the week and the type of train. Generally, there are around 20 departures and arrivals throughout the day. The first departure is 05:10, and the last train of the day leaves at 00:27.

No, unfortunately there are no direct trains between Herne Bay & Billingshurst. However, there are 20 possible journeys which require a change.
Southeastern, Thameslink and Southern are the main train operating companies running services between Herne Bay and Billingshurst.

Herne Bay Train Station, nestled in the picturesque coastal town of the same name, serves as a vital link for both daily commuters and those venturing out on leisure trips. Known for its charming seaside environment, Herne Bay offers more than just beautiful views and serene beaches; it is also a gateway to a network of travel possibilities perfect for exploring the rest of Kent and beyond.
When planning your journey, the station offers convenient ticket purchasing options to streamline your travel experience. The ticket office opens from 6:10 AM to 7: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 9:10 AM to 4:00 PM on Sundays. With ticket machines readily available and located on Platform 2, collecting tickets purchased online couldn't be easier. Smartcard technology is also supported at this station, although smartcard validators are not present, ensuring you're prepared for both contemporary and traditional ticketing methods.
Herne Bay Train Station ensures passengers receive quality support and amenities throughout their visit. Help points are installed for assistance, accompanied by comprehensive departure screens and announcements. Operating hours for staff help closely match ticket office hours, ensuring personal assistance when necessary. Although the station lacks luggage storage, lost property can be managed through Southeastern Customer Services.
Accessible facilities are notably present to assist passengers with mobility constraints. Step-free access is available to Platform 2, while Platform 1 has step access only. A range of supportive facilities, such as acc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and ramps for train access, contribute to an inclusive travel environment. For a touch of comfort, seating areas are provided, though waiting rooms are absent, making outside seating the principal option for relaxation during your wait.
The station yard is a hub of connectivity, offering options that extend well beyond train services. Taxis are conveniently accessible from the side of the station, while the station forecourt accommodates rail replacement services when needed. Nestled in the picturesque West Sussex, Billingshurst Train Station serves as a convenient gateway for both commuters and leisure travelers alike. Managed by Southern Railway, this station is part of the Arun Valley Line and offers regular services that make it easy to explore the vibrant towns and beautiful countryside of South East England. Whether you're heading into the hustle and bustle of London for work or exploring the historic attractions in the surrounding area, Billingshurst Train Station has got you covered.
Billingshurst Train Station is well-equipped to accommodate the needs of its passengers. The ticket office is open from early morning to late evening during weekdays, with reduced hours over the weekend, allowing you to plan your journey flexibly. For those who prefer the convenience of technology, ticket machines are available for both ticket purchases and collection. Plus, these machines support discounts for Disabled Persons Railcard holders, ensuring that everyone can easily access rail travel. With smartcard validators, you can enjoy the ease of contactless travel.
For your comfort and security, the station provides CCTV coverage, and customer help points are strategically placed on the platforms for any assistance you may require. Although the station lacks waiting rooms and accessible toilets, there's still seating available for passengers and a staff-operated ramp ensures that boarding is feasible for all, despite step-free access being limited in certain areas.
Although Billingshurst has limited step-free access between platforms, assistance is just a call away. Staff are on hand during key hours, and a dedicated number for assisted travel is available for arranging any special requirements you might have. It’s always a wise idea to notify the station in advance to ensure a smoother journey. Just remember, there's no waiting room office, so plan your arrival time accordingly, especially during rainy days.
Continuing your journey from Billingshurst Train Station is seamless with numerous transportation links. While there's currently no cycle hire available, the station does offer bicycle storage on platforms 1 and 2, albeit without shelter.
